WebWhiskers act as built-in rulers. Whiskers also function as miniature measuring tapes that vibrate and transmit signals to a cat’s brain. When cats poke their heads into narrow spaces, they use their whiskers to judge whether the rest of their body will fit through. That’s why a cat’s facial whiskers are approximately as wide as their body. Some cat breeds are born with naturally weak whiskers, most notably due to the rex gene. The rex gene results in a short, curly coat and sparse whiskers. Kittens born with the rex gene will lose their whiskers more often than kittens without the rex gene. poth texas history
